CIO2_MAX_BUFFERS
for (i = 0, j = q->bufs_first; i < CIO2_MAX_BUFFERS;
i++, j = (j + 1) % CIO2_MAX_BUFFERS)
if (i == CIO2_MAX_BUFFERS)
CIO2_MAX_BUFFERS, j);
CIO2_MAX_BUFFERS, j);
for (i = 0; i < CIO2_MAX_BUFFERS; i++)
const u32 num_buffers1 = CIO2_MAX_BUFFERS - 1;
q->bufs_first = (q->bufs_first + 1) % CIO2_MAX_BUFFERS;
for (i = 0; i < CIO2_MAX_BUFFERS; i++) {
*num_buffers = clamp_val(*num_buffers, 1, CIO2_MAX_BUFFERS);
for (i = 0; i < CIO2_MAX_BUFFERS; i++) {
fbpt_rp = (fbpt_rp + 1) % CIO2_MAX_BUFFERS;
next = (fbpt_rp + 1) % CIO2_MAX_BUFFERS;
for (i = 0; i < CIO2_MAX_BUFFERS; i++) {
q->bufs_next = (next + 1) % CIO2_MAX_BUFFERS;
next = (next + 1) % CIO2_MAX_BUFFERS;
struct cio2_buffer *bufs[CIO2_MAX_BUFFERS];
#define CIO2_FBPT_SIZE (CIO2_MAX_BUFFERS * CIO2_MAX_LOPS * \